云盘项目建设技术方案_第1页
云盘项目建设技术方案_第2页
云盘项目建设技术方案_第3页
云盘项目建设技术方案_第4页
云盘项目建设技术方案_第5页
已阅读5页,还剩23页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

云盘项目建设技术方案目录引言技术架构技术选型实施步骤技术难点与解决方案未来展望01引言0102项目背景云存储技术的兴起为数据存储提供了新的解决方案,具有高可用性、高可扩展性和低成本等优势。当前,随着信息技术的快速发展,数据存储需求呈现爆炸性增长,传统的本地存储方式已经无法满足需求。

项目目标构建一个高效、安全、可靠的云盘系统,满足用户的数据存储和管理需求。提高数据存储的可用性和可扩展性,降低存储成本。提供方便、快捷的数据共享和备份功能,保障用户数据的安全性和完整性。02技术架构描述基础设施架构的目标、原则和设计理念。基础设施架构概述根据业务需求和规模,规划所需的服务器、虚拟机等计算资源。计算资源选择合适的存储设备和技术,确保数据的安全、可靠和高效存储。存储资源设计网络拓扑结构,确保数据传输的稳定、安全和高效。网络资源基础设施架构描述平台架构的目标、原则和设计理念。平台架构概述设计数据采集、存储、处理和分析的流程,选择合适的数据处理技术和工具。数据处理确保平台的安全性,包括数据加密、身份认证、访问控制等。平台安全设计可扩展的平台架构,以满足业务增长的需求。平台扩展性平台架构应用架构概述根据业务需求,设计应用的功能模块和业务流程。应用功能应用性能应用可维护性01020403设计易于维护和升级的应用架构,降低维护成本。描述应用架构的目标、原则和设计理念。优化应用性能,提高应用的响应速度和稳定性。应用架构03技术选型采用分布式存储系统,将数据分散存储在多个节点上,以提高存储容量和数据可靠性。分布式存储采用对象存储技术,支持存储大量非结构化数据,如图片、视频、文档等。对象存储提供高性能的块设备存储,适用于需要随机读写的场景,如数据库等。块存储存储技术利用内容分发网络(CDN)加速数据传输,提高用户访问速度。CDN加速数据压缩数据加密采用数据压缩技术,减少数据传输量,提高传输效率。对传输的数据进行加密,确保数据传输过程中的安全性。030201传输技术采用多因素认证或动态令牌等身份认证方式,确保用户身份的安全性。身份认证实施严格的访问控制策略,限制用户对数据的访问权限。访问控制定期备份数据,并提供快速恢复机制,确保数据安全。数据备份与恢复安全技术采用实时备份技术,确保数据在任何时间点都能快速恢复。实时备份仅备份发生更改的数据,减少备份时间和存储空间占用。增量备份建立异地容灾中心,确保在灾难情况下能够快速恢复数据和业务运行。异地容灾备份与恢复技术04实施步骤需求梳理对收集到的需求进行分类、整理和筛选,明确项目的核心需求和扩展需求。需求确认与项目相关人员共同确认需求,确保双方对需求的理解一致,避免后续开发过程中的误解和返工。需求调研通过与项目相关人员进行深入交流,了解他们对云盘项目的需求和期望,为后续系统设计提供依据。需求分析03界面设计根据用户使用习惯和需求,设计友好的用户界面,提高用户体验和操作便捷性。01系统架构设计根据需求分析结果,设计云盘系统的整体架构,包括系统模块、模块间的关系和数据流向等。02数据库设计根据业务需求,设计数据库表结构、字段、数据类型和关系等,确保数据存储的合理性和高效性。系统设计123根据界面设计稿,使用HTML、CSS和JavaScript等技术实现前端页面和交互效果。前端开发根据系统设计,采用合适的后端语言和框架进行后端功能开发,实现数据存储、处理和传输等功能。后端开发为了与其他系统进行集成,需要开发相应的API接口,实现数据的交换和共享。接口开发系统开发功能测试对云盘系统的各项功能进行测试,确保功能符合需求且运行稳定。性能测试测试系统的性能指标,如响应时间、吞吐量等,确保系统在高负载情况下仍能保持良好的性能。安全测试检测系统的安全性,如数据加密、权限控制等,确保系统在数据传输和存储时的安全可靠。系统测试系统部署将开发完成的云盘系统部署到目标环境中,并进行相应的配置和优化。监控和维护对云盘系统进行实时监控和维护,确保系统稳定运行和及时处理故障。环境准备搭建云盘系统的运行环境,包括服务器、网络设备和安全设备等。系统部署05技术难点与解决方案数据加密存储采用高级加密算法对用户数据进行加密存储,确保数据在云端的安全性。访问控制与权限管理实施严格的访问控制和权限管理机制,限制对数据的访问和操作。数据备份与恢复建立完善的数据备份和恢复机制,确保数据在意外情况下能够迅速恢复。数据安全问题030201优化数据传输协议支持多通道并发传输,提高数据上传和下载的效率。多通道并发传输缓存技术利用缓存技术,将常用数据缓存在本地,减少对云端的访问次数。采用高效的数据传输协议,减少数据在传输过程中的延迟和损耗。传输速度问题采用负载均衡技术,将用户请求分发到多个服务器上,提高系统的处理能力。负载均衡支持横向扩展,通过增加服务器数量来应对高并发访问压力。横向扩展优化系统资源配置,提高服务器的处理性能和响应速度。资源优化高并发访问问题06未来展望人工智能与云盘的结合利用人工智能技术对云盘中的文件进行智能分类、搜索和推荐,提高用户的使用体验。区块链技术在云盘中的应用通过区块链技术实现云盘数据的分布式存储和加密保护,提高数据的安全性和可靠性。5G网络与云盘的融合借助5G网络的高速传输和低延迟特性,实现云盘文件的高速上传和下载,提升用户的使用体验。技术发展方向通过增加服务器数量和存储设备,实现云盘系统的横向扩展,满足用户量的增长需求。横向扩展通过升级

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论